      <content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Photo credit Cascoantiguoba, CC BY-SA 4.0. Most cathedrals aspire upward. Badajoz Cathedral hunkers down. With its thick walls, sturdy bastions, and Gothic merlons crowning every surface, the Metropolitan Cathedral of Saint John the Baptist looks less like a house of worship than a stronghold prepared for siege -- which, given Badajoz's position on one of the most fought-over borders in European history, was entirely the point. Situated outside the city's Moorish citadel in the Campo de San Juan, this church was built to serve God and, if necessary, to withstand armies.</p>
